The Argent Train Engine Number 7 was donated to the town of Hardeeville upon the closing of the Argent Lumber Company.
This wood-burning steam engine with a balloon smokestack was built by the H.K. Concierge Company around 1910. It was made use of by the Argent Lumber Company to transport lumber from the woodland to the mill. In 1960, the engine was donated to the City of Hardeeville website link for show and tell as a testament to the role that the lumber and lumber industry played in the economic growth of Hardeeville.
